5.7AdjustingToeIn/ToeOut
1.Loosen,butdonotremovethesocketscrewsAandclampsB
thatsecurecamberinsertsCtothecamberbarD.
2.SlowlyrotatethecamberinsertCuntiltherearwheelsare
approximatelyinastraightline.
3.SecurelytightenthesocketscrewsAandclampsBthatsecure
thecamberinsertsCtothecamberbarD.
4.Measurethedistancebetweenthecenterlinesattherearand
frontoftherearwheelsatapproximately12inches(30cm)
fromtheground/floor.Referto5.6DeterminingToeIn/Toe
Out,page49.
5.RepeatSTEPS1-4untilthetoein/toeoutmeasurementisless
than1/8-inch(0.3175cm)(formaximumrollability).
5.8AdjustingHandCrank
WARNING!
–Afteranyadjustments,repairorserviceandbefore
use,makesureallattachinghardwareistightened
securely.Otherwiseinjuryordamagemayoccur.
DiagonalAdjustment
1.Loosen,butdonotremovetheallennutsthatsecurethecrank
handlestothefork.
2.Slidethecrankhandlesupand/ordownuntilthepropertension
onthechainisachieved.
Theproperchaintensionwillbeapproximately1/2-inch
(1.27cm)ofchainslack.
Ifcrankisindesiredpositionbutchaintensionisnot
correct,linksMUSTbeaddedtoorremovedfromthe
chaintocorrectthetension.
Thisshouldbeperformedbyaqualifiedtechnician.
3.Tightentheclampthatsecuresthecrankhandlestothefork
securely.
